5步快速上手抖音直播数据采集:douyin-live-go新手指南
【免费下载链接】douyin-live-go抖音(web) 弹幕爬虫 golang 实现项目地址: https://gitcode.com/gh_mirrors/do/douyin-live-go
在直播电商蓬勃发展的今天,获取实时直播间数据已成为运营决策的关键环节。面对海量弹幕、礼物和用户互动信息,传统人工记录方式显得力不从心。douyin-live-go作为一款轻量级Golang工具,让数据采集变得简单高效!🚀
为什么你需要这个工具?
douyin-live-go专为普通用户设计,无需深厚技术背景即可快速上手。它能帮你自动采集:
- 💬 实时弹幕内容及用户信息
- 🎁 礼物赠送详情与统计
- 👥 用户入场离场行为记录
- ❤️ 点赞互动等基础行为数据
相比复杂的爬虫系统,它只需要简单配置就能稳定运行,内存占用极低却具备高并发处理能力。
5步快速启动指南
第一步:环境准备
确保你的电脑已安装Go 1.16或更高版本。打开终端输入:
go version如果显示版本号,说明环境就绪!
第二步:获取项目代码
在终端中执行以下命令:
git clone https://gitcode.com/gh_mirrors/do/douyin-live-go cd douyin-live-go第三步:配置直播间
打开main.go文件,找到直播间配置部分,将"你的直播间ID"替换为实际ID:
r, err := NewRoom("https://live.douyin.com/你的直播间ID")第四步:启动数据采集
在项目目录下运行:
go run .第五步:查看实时数据
启动成功后,你将看到类似输出:
[弹幕] 用户小明 : 主播讲得真好 [礼物] 小红 : 粉丝团灯牌 * 1 [入场] 新用户加入直播间数据应用场景解析
采集到的数据可以帮你:
直播效果分析
通过弹幕内容识别用户关注点,优化直播话术和产品展示方式。
用户行为洞察
分析用户活跃时间段和互动偏好,制定精准的运营策略。
市场竞品监控
同时追踪多个直播间,了解行业动态和竞品表现。
技术架构概览
douyin-live-go采用简洁的技术设计:
- 网络连接:room.go 管理WebSocket连接
- 数据解析:protobuf/dy.proto 定义数据结构
- 消息处理:实时分类处理不同类型的数据消息
常见问题解答
Q: 连接失败怎么办?A: 确认直播间正在直播,检查网络连接是否正常。
Q: 数据不完整?A: 确保使用最新版本,网络环境稳定。
Q: 如何长期运行?A: 可部署到服务器,实现24小时不间断数据采集。
douyin-live-go让你轻松掌握直播数据采集技能,为业务决策提供有力支持!🌟
【免费下载链接】douyin-live-go抖音(web) 弹幕爬虫 golang 实现项目地址: https://gitcode.com/gh_mirrors/do/douyin-live-go
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考